Hohoe-North MP appeals for calm

Mr. Prince-Jacob Hayibor, the Member of Parliament for Hohoe North, has appealed to the people of Gbi Traditional Area and members of the Muslim Community to exercise restraint in the conflict that had claimed lives and destruction of property.

He urged all the parties to be calm while the security apparatus handled the matter for justice to prevail.

Mr. Hayibor, who cut short his participation in an International Labour Organisation Conference in Geneva, told the GNA in an interview that the conflict was “grievous and unfortunate” and said it would have a lasting toll on the local economy.

He appealed for calm and said “There are no winners or losers in a situation like this.”

Mr. Hayibor appealed to the people not to lose confidence in the security agencies adding that they should support them to reach a peaceful settlement.

He expressed his sympathy to the bereaved families and those who lost property.**
